Banc of California Legal Assistant Salaries in Dalton, GA

The average Banc of California Legal Assistant in Dalton, GA earns an estimated $80,704 annually. Banc of California's Legal Assistant compensation is $20,542 more than the US average for a Legal Assistant.

In Dalton, GA, The Legal Department at Banc of California earns $5,649 more on average than the Product Department.
